Location

Oulton is a wonderful area of Suffolk close to the popular seaside town of Lowestoft. Close by is Oulton Broad, one of the finest stretches of inland water in the UK and forms the southern gateway to the Broads National Park. A popular place to come for water sports such as; sailing, canoeing, rowing & boating as well as pampering & self-indulgence sessions in restaurants, cafes, pubs, wine bars, shops & health & beauty salons. Oulton is well connected with 2 train stations offering direct services to Norwich and Ipswich, with fast and frequent transfers directly to London.
